Summary :
We are seeking a skilled Data Engineer to contribute to our data infrastructure and pipeline development. This role is ideal for a professional with solid SQL Server experience who is ready to take on more complex projects and begin developing leadership skills. The successful candidate will work independently on data engineering tasks while collaborating closely with senior team members and stakeholders.
Responsibilities :
- Design and develop robust data pipelines using SQL Server Integration Services (SSIS) and related tools
- Build and maintain complex database schemas, stored procedures, functions, and views in SQL Server
- Implement data quality frameworks and validation processes to ensure data integrity
- Optimize database performance through query tuning, indexing strategies, and system monitoring
- Collaborate with business analysts and stakeholders to gather and translate data requirements
- Develop and maintain ETL / ELT processes for both batch and incremental data loads
- Monitor data pipeline performance and proactively address issues
- Document technical processes, data flows, and system configurations
- Participate in code reviews and contribute to technical standards and best practices
- Support junior engineers through knowledge sharing and informal mentoring
- Investigate and resolve data discrepancies and pipeline failures
